Review of Boys Don't Cry (1999) by Owen Gleiberman for Entertainment Weekly — 18 May 2001
It's Swank, however, who's the revelation. By the end, her Brandon/Teena is beyond male or female. It's as if we were simply glimpsing the character's soul, in all its yearning and conflicted beauty.
